The things to consider before starting a Home Renovation Project

If you’re planning a home renovation project, there are many factors you need to consider before starting the project. While renovating your home can be exciting, it’s important to take the time to plan carefully to ensure that the end result is what you envision and that it fits within your budget. In this blog post, we’ll discuss some key things to consider before starting a home renovation project.

Determine Your Budget

Before you start any renovation project, it’s essential to determine your budget. Renovations can quickly become expensive, so you need to establish how much you can afford to spend before you begin. Make sure to include any unforeseen costs, such as repairs or upgrades, to ensure that you don’t go over budget.

Assess Your Needs

Think about why you want to renovate your home. Are you looking to increase your living space, modernise your home or add value to your property? Understanding your needs will help you focus your renovation plans and ensure that you’re not spending money on things that aren’t necessary.

Plan Your Timeline

Renovations can be disruptive to your daily routine, so it’s important to plan your timeline carefully. Consider factors such as when you want the renovation to be completed, how long it will take and whether you need to vacate the property during the renovation. Make sure to factor in any contingencies or delays, such as weather or unexpected repairs.

Get the Necessary Permits

Depending on the scope of your renovation, you may need to obtain permits from your local government. Permits are required to ensure that your renovation meets local building codes and safety standards. Your contractor should be able to advise you on what permits you need and help you obtain them.

Consider Your Neighborhood

If you’re renovating to add value to your property, it’s important to consider your neighbourhood. You don’t want to overspend on renovations that won’t add value to your area. Research what types of renovations are common in your neighbourhood and what buyers are looking for.

Consider Energy Efficiency

Renovations are an excellent opportunity to improve the energy efficiency of your home. Consider upgrading insulation, installing new windows or investing in energy-efficient appliances. These upgrades can save you money on your energy bills and increase the value of your property.

Think About Resale Value

Even if you’re not planning on selling your home, it’s important to consider resale value when renovating. Keep in mind that design trends come and go and what’s popular now may not be in a few years. Choose timeless designs and materials that will appeal to a wide range of buyers.

Plan for the Unexpected

Even with careful planning, unexpected issues can arise during a renovation project. Make sure to have a contingency plan in place in case of delays or additional costs. Build some flexibility into your timeline and budget to allow for any unforeseen circumstances.

Consider the Environmental Impact

Renovations can have a significant environmental impact, so it’s important to consider sustainability. Look for eco-friendly materials and products and consider recycling or repurposing items when possible. You can also consider incorporating renewable energy sources, such as solar panels or geothermal systems.

Choose the Right Contractor

Choosing the right contractor is crucial to the success of your renovation project. Look for a reputable contractor with experience in the type of renovation you’re planning. Check references and ask to see examples of their work. Make sure that the contractor you choose is licensed and insured.
